Subtract 1/15 from 40/12

1st number: 3 4/12, 2nd number: 1/15

40/12 - 1/15 is 49/15.

Steps for subtracting fractions

  1. Find the least common denominator or LCM of the two denominators:
    LCM of 12 and 15 is 60

    Next, find the equivalent fraction of both fractional numbers with denominator 60
  2. For the 1st fraction, since 12 × 5 = 60,
    40/12 = 40 × 5/12 × 5 = 200/60
  3. Likewise, for the 2nd fraction, since 15 × 4 = 60,
    1/15 = 1 × 4/15 × 4 = 4/60
  4. Subtract the two like fractions:
    200/60 - 4/60 = 200 - 4/60 = 196/60
  5. After reducing the fraction, the answer is 49/15
